Abstract

A pigment preparation comprising (i) 10-80% by wt. of a platelet-shaped substrate coated with a metal oxide, and (ii) 20-90% by wt. of an active pigment.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A pigment preparation comprising an organic binder containing (i) 10-80% by wt. of a platelet-shaped substrate coated with a metal oxide, and   (ii) 20-90% by wt. of an active pigment.   
     
     
       2. A pigment preparation according to claim 1, wherein the platelet-shaped substrate coated with a metal oxide is mica coated with titanium dioxide or iron oxide. 
     
     
       3. A pigment preparation according to claim 1, wherein the active pigment is a compound which is capable of converting primary corrosion products which form in defects of an organic coating into solid compounds which are stable to water. 
     
     
       4. A pigment preparation according to claim 1, wherein the active pigment is a material which binds hydroxide ions. 
     
     
       5. A pigment preparation according to claim 1, wherein the active pigment is zinc phosphate, zinc borate or calcium metaphosphate. 
     
     
       6. A pigment preparation according to claim 1, wherein the active pigment is a monomeric and/or polymeric, metal-free or metal-containing, chelate complex compound of formulae I or II: ##STR2## wherein A and B are each independently an aromatic or cycloaliphatic radical which optionally contain hetero-atoms and is optionally substituted by aryl, alkyl, halogen, oxygen-containing, sulfur-containing or nitrogen-containing groups, R 1 , R 2     R 3  and R 4  are H atoms or alkyl radicals, and   Me is Fe, Ni, Co, Mn, Bi, Sn, Zn or H 2 .   
     
     
       7. A pigment preparation according to claim 1, wherein the active pigment is a phthalocyanine, tetraarylporphyrin or a tetraazaannulene. 
     
     
       8. A pigment preparation according to claim 1, wherein the active pigment is a metaphosphate, bi- or triphosphate, silica gel, silicate, aluminosilicate or calcite. 
     
     
       9. A pigment preparation according to claim 1, wherein the organic binder has carboxyl group-containing polymer particles. 
     
     
       10. An anti-corrosion coating material comprising a pigment preparation according to claim 1. 
     
     
       11. An anti-corrosion coating material according to claim 10, containing a water-dilutable polymer dispersion. 
     
     
       12. An anti-corrosion coating material according to claim 10, containing an organic polymer dispersion. 
     
     
       13. A pigment preparation comprising an organic binder containing: (a) an active pigment; and   (b) a platelet-shaped substrate coated with a metal oxide in an amount effective to increase corrosion resistance of the active pigment.
